What Can a Thoracic Surgery Expert Witness Opine On?

Lung Resection

Removal of part or all of a lung.

Thoracotomy

Surgical opening of the chest cavity.

Video-Assisted Thoracoscopic Surgery (VATS)

Minimally invasive lung surgery using cameras.

Mediastinoscopy

Examination of the mediastinum area.

Pleurodesis

Procedure to eliminate pleural space.

Chest Tube Insertion

Placement of tube to drain air/fluid.

FAQs for Thoracic Surgery Expert Witnesses

What is a thoracic surgery expert witness?

A thoracic surgery expert witness is a board-certified surgeon who explains standards of care in chest, lung, and heart surgery cases. They assist by reviewing medical records, offering opinions, and testifying to clarify complex thoracic surgery issues.

In what case types can a thoracic surgery expert witness provide beneficial insights?

A thoracic surgery expert witness provides insights in medical malpractice, surgical error, misdiagnosis, standard-of-care, trauma, cardiac, pulmonary, and post‑operative complication cases.

How can a thoracic surgery expert witness evaluate alleged intraoperative negligence?

A thoracic surgery expert witness evaluates alleged intraoperative negligence by reviewing records, operative technique, complications, and comparing care to accepted surgical standards.

What thoracic surgery expert witness qualifications are most persuasive at trial?

The most persuasive thoracic surgery expert witness qualifications are board certification, active surgical practice, academic or research roles, and prior credible courtroom testimony.

How does a thoracic surgery expert witness analyze postoperative complication causation?

A thoracic surgery expert witness analyzes postoperative complication causation by reviewing records, surgical technique, standards of care, timing, risk factors, and alternative medical explanations.
